Krupp Wins CMP Western Games John C. Garand Match as Rutherford Wins Springfield and Vintage Matches

By Steve Cooper, CMP Writer


PHOENIX, ARIZONA – Maury Krupp, 57, of Tucson, Arizona, won the John C. Garand Match, firing an aggregate score of 293-6X. As a result of his first place finish, Krupp took home a CMP Match Winner engraved plaque and a Fancy Grade M1 rifle stock donated by Dupage Trading Company of Chandler, Arizona.

Krupp fired a 98-3X in prone slow, a 99-1X in prone rapid and an impressive 96-2X in standing slow-fire.

William Aten, 58, of Kingwood, Texas, finished in second place, six points back with an aggregate score of 287-7X in a tiebreaker over third place finisher Arland Anderson, 60, of Las Vegas, Nevada. With one more center-X than Anderson, Aten stayed close to Krupp through the prone series, shooting 98-3X and 98-4X and finished with a 91-0X in standing to clinch second and a gold achievement medal.

Glendale “Don” Rutherford, 58, Tallapoosa, Georgia, winner of the overall GSM 3-Gun Match, placed first in the Springfield and Vintage Military rifle matches with aggregate scores of 289-11X and 292-9X, respectively.

Rutherford received a CMP Match Winner plaque for each event plus he was awarded a Fancy Grade Springfield A3 rifle stock from the Dupage Trading Company for being an overall two-event winner.

John C. Garand Match winner Maury Krupp placed second behind Rutherford in the Springfield Match, firing 98-3X, 96-2X, and 89-0X for a 283-5X aggregate. Michael Miller, 63, of Downey, California, finished third and was the High Senior shooter in the match, firing a 282-10X. Miller took home a Criterion M1Garand rifle barrel and an engraved CMP plaque for his efforts as High Senior. Chief Rick Jones (USN) 52, of Auburn, California, was the high handicap winner of the Springfield Match, firing a 254-3X and was awarded an engraved CMP plaque.

Bill Poole, 49, of Scottsdale, Arizona, placed second in the Vintage Military rifle match with an aggregate score of 285-4X and took home a gold achievement medal while High Senior, Lee McKinney 64, of Rio Rico, Arizona, placed third with a total score of 281-2X, taking home an engraved CMP High Senior plaque. High Handicap winner Fritz Reuter, 68, of Mesa, Arizona, was awarded a CMP plaque for greatest improvement over his baseline handicap in the Vintage Military match.
